Jennifer Harmon was born on December 3, 1943 in Pasadena, California, USA. She is an actress, known for One Life to Live (1968), How to Survive a Marriage (1974) and Guiding Light (1952).

Harmon played villainous Cathy Craig in the ABC soap opera, "One Life to Live" (1976-78). For this performance, she received Daytime Emmy Award for Outstanding Lead Actress in a Drama Series nomination in 1978.

Jennifer Harmon was an American actress, who mostly appeared on Broadway and television soap operas.

Despite her surname, Harmon is not related to the popular actor Mark Harmon, nor to his family, the Harmon-Nelson family (a well-known California show business family).

Harmon made her Broadway debut in 1965, appearing in You Can't Take It With You. Her other Broadway credits including The School for Scandal, Right You Are If You Think You Are, We, Comrades Three, The Wild Duck, The Cherry Orchard, The Show-Off, Blithe Spirit, The Sisters Rosensweig, The Little Foxes, The Deep Blue Sea, Amy's View, The Dinner Party, The Glass Menagerie, Seascape, Barefoot in the Park, Dividing the Estate and Other Desert Cities.

She was lead actress in the NBC soap opera, How to Survive a Marriage (1974-75).

She returned to One Life to Live in 1991 playing Victoria Lord's attorney for multiple episodes and the same year played Jean Weatherill on Guiding Light. In 1995, she played Lucretia Jones on the ABC soap opera, Loving. Harmon also guest-starred on Madigan, Barnaby Jones, Dallas, St. Elsewhere, Homicide: Life on the Street, The Cosby Mysteries, Law & Order, Oz, and The Good Wife. She also starred in 21 episodes of the CBS Radio Mystery Theater, which ran from January of 1974 to December of 1982
